‘India Braces for Tougher Vehicle Emission Standards’

Amit Bhandari, Fellow, Energy and Environment Studies, Gateway House, was quoted in New Energy in a story on vehicle emissions.

post image

Below is the quote from Amit Bhandari;

Amit Bhandari from Mumbai-based think tank Gateway House told EI New Energy that although India needs “such drastic measures,” due to deteriorating air quality, it also needs to consider that vehicular emissions are just a part of the air quality problem. “There are bigger culprits,” he said, like the burning of waste in fields after crop harvesting and dust from construction sites. “Unless government addresses those, just making fuel quality norms more stringent would do little,” Bhandari noted.
